RingHom.StableUnderCompositionWithLocalizationAwayTarget
({R S : Type u} → [inst : CommRing R] → [inst_1 : CommRing S] → (R →+* S) → Prop) → PropA property P of ring homs satisfies RingHom.StableUnderCompositionWithLocalizationAway
if whenever P holds for f it also holds for the composition with
localization maps on the target.
